RSA 339-B:13: Duties of Suppliers.

- Fuel Oil System Conversion
Any fuel supplier who installs a fuel heating system, at the request of a property owner, where a fuel oil heating system already exists, shall be responsible for the following:
I. Securely capping both ends of all fill pipes connected to the fuel tank or taking such other measures as are reasonably designed to render the fill pipes inoperable; and
II. Providing a written recommendation to the property owner, prior to the date of conversion, that he notify the fuel oil dealer that a conversion shall take place for the purpose of terminating deliveries of fuel oil to the premises.
